怎么把excel表格转换成dat

怎么把excel表格转换成dat

将Excel表格转换为DAT文件的方法包括使用Excel自带的导出功能、使用编程语言如Python或R进行转换、以及第三方工具等,这些方法各有优劣。接下来,我们将详细介绍其中一种方法,即通过Excel自带的导出功能,将一个Excel表格转换为DAT文件。

一、使用Excel导出功能

1. 准备Excel文件

首先,确保你的Excel文件已准备好并且数据格式正确。你需要检查数据是否包含任何空白行、错误的公式等,因为这些可能会影响导出的结果。

2. 导出为CSV文件

在Excel中打开你的文件,选择“文件”菜单,然后选择“另存为”。在文件类型中选择“CSV(逗号分隔)”,然后保存文件。这一步将你的Excel数据转换为CSV格式,这是DAT文件转换的第一步。

3. 修改文件扩展名

将保存的CSV文件的扩展名从“.csv”更改为“.dat”。这一步完成后,你的文件将成为一个DAT文件。

二、使用Python进行转换

1. 安装必要的库

首先,你需要确保你的系统上已经安装了Python及其相关库,如pandas。你可以通过以下命令安装pandas:

pip install pandas

2. 编写转换脚本

编写一个Python脚本来读取Excel文件并将其转换为DAT文件。以下是一个简单的示例代码:

import pandas as pd

读取Excel文件

df = pd.read_excel('yourfile.xlsx')

保存为CSV文件

df.to_csv('yourfile.dat', index=False, sep='t')

这个脚本将读取Excel文件并将其保存为一个以制表符分隔的DAT文件。

三、使用R语言进行转换

1. 安装必要的包

在R中,你需要安装readxldata.table包。可以通过以下命令安装:

install.packages("readxl")

install.packages("data.table")

2. 编写转换脚本

使用以下代码来读取Excel文件并将其转换为DAT文件:

library(readxl)

library(data.table)

读取Excel文件

df <- read_excel("yourfile.xlsx")

保存为DAT文件

fwrite(df, "yourfile.dat", sep = "t")

这个脚本将读取Excel文件并将其保存为一个以制表符分隔的DAT文件。

四、使用第三方工具

1. 选择合适的工具

有许多在线工具和桌面软件可以实现Excel到DAT的转换。你可以选择一个符合你需求的工具,例如Convertio、Zamzar等。

2. 上传并转换

按照工具的指示上传你的Excel文件并选择输出格式为DAT文件。工具会自动完成转换并提供下载链接。

五、转换过程中的注意事项

1. 数据完整性

确保在转换过程中没有数据丢失或格式错误。你可以通过对比原始Excel文件和转换后的DAT文件来确认数据的完整性。

2. 文件格式

不同的DAT文件格式可能有不同的要求(如分隔符、编码等),你需要根据具体需求选择合适的格式。

3. 自动化处理

如果你需要经常进行此类转换,建议使用编程语言编写脚本以实现自动化处理,这样可以提高效率并减少手动操作的错误。

总的来说,将Excel表格转换为DAT文件的方法多种多样,你可以根据自己的需求和技术水平选择最合适的方法。通过Excel自带的导出功能可以快速完成基本的转换,而编程语言如Python和R则提供了更高的灵活性和自动化能力。第三方工具则提供了便捷的在线转换服务。无论选择哪种方法,确保数据的完整性和正确性始终是最重要的。

相关问答FAQs:

1. 我该如何将Excel表格转换为dat文件?

要将Excel表格转换为dat文件,你可以按照以下步骤进行操作:

  • 打开Excel表格并确保它包含你需要转换的数据。
  • 选择“文件”菜单,然后点击“另存为”选项。
  • 在“另存为”对话框中,选择一个保存位置,并将文件类型设置为“文本(Tab分隔)(*.txt)”。
  • 点击“保存”按钮,并在弹出的选项对话框中选择“是”,以确保将文件保存为纯文本格式。
  • 关闭Excel表格,然后在保存的位置找到新创建的文本文件。
  • 将文件的扩展名从.txt更改为.dat,这样你就成功将Excel表格转换为dat文件了。

2. 如何将Excel表格中的数据转换成dat格式?

将Excel表格中的数据转换成dat格式非常简单。只需按照以下步骤操作:

  • 打开Excel表格并选择你想要转换的数据。
  • 复制选定的数据(按Ctrl+C或右键点击并选择“复制”)。
  • 打开一个文本编辑器(例如记事本)。
  • 在文本编辑器中,粘贴刚才复制的数据(按Ctrl+V或右键点击并选择“粘贴”)。
  • 将文本编辑器中的文件保存为.dat格式(选择“另存为”选项,并将文件类型设置为.dat)。
  • 选择一个保存位置并命名你的文件,然后点击“保存”按钮。
  • 现在,你已经成功将Excel表格中的数据转换成dat格式了。

3. 我该如何使用软件将Excel表格转换为dat文件?

要使用软件将Excel表格转换为dat文件,你可以选择以下方法:

  • 下载并安装一个能够将Excel表格转换为dat文件的软件,如Excel转dat转换器。
  • 打开软件,并导入需要转换的Excel表格文件。
  • 在软件界面上选择转换选项,并设置转换参数,如目标文件类型为dat。
  • 点击“开始转换”或类似按钮,开始执行转换过程。
  • 等待转换完成后,软件将生成一个dat格式的文件。
  • 导航到输出文件的保存位置,并查找转换后的dat文件。
  • 现在,你已经成功使用软件将Excel表格转换为dat文件了。

希望以上回答能够帮助你将Excel表格转换为dat文件。如果还有其他问题,请随时向我们提问。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4800410

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部